Streaming Story Lab: Turning Streams into TV Shows

With my background in filmmaking, earning a bachelor’s degree in Film and completing my master’s degree in Filmmaking this summer, I believe every stream has the potential to become a story. Inspired by anime like One Piece and Katekyo Hitman Reborn!, this club will teach students how to create characters, world-build, and develop exciting story arcs that can transform livestreams into engaging TV-show-style experiences.

Through fun games, creative challenges, and collaborative activities, members will learn storytelling fundamentals and create their own short story or streaming project by the end of the semester. My name is Shamar “Vibez” Binns, a filmmaker, content creator, interviewer, and founder of Vibez Central Media.

I earned my bachelor’s degree in Film and am currently completing my master’s degree in Filmmaking. As a proud Jamaican-American creator, I am passionate about storytelling, media production, and celebrating diverse cultures through film, streaming, and digital content. Over the years, I have interviewed creators, voice actors, cosplayers, artists, and fans at conventions and pop culture events, creating engaging conversations about anime, gaming, film, and geek culture.

My work focuses on bringing communities together while highlighting the creativity and passion that make these spaces unique. I also take pride in sharing and celebrating my Jamaican heritage, incorporating Caribbean culture, storytelling traditions, and community values into my projects and content. Inspired by anime, filmmaking, and real-life experiences, I strive to create content that entertains, educates, and inspires others to tell their own stories. Through Vibez Central Media, my goal is to provide a platform where creativity, culture, and community can thrive.
